#1 Top Scoop Code Violation

4813 Beech Dr - Code Violation: pigs kept in hot trailer

Owner Collazo Abdiel Reyes has an open property maintenance/code violation case at 4813 Beech Dr after neighbors reported pigs being kept in a hot trailer all week and weekend slaughtering. Complaints say the situation has attracted rats and flies, produced strong odors and blood running into the ditch, and an inspector reportedly visited last week though no completed inspections are listed.

#2 Top Scoop Code Violation

11353 TAZWELL DR opened for code violation due to ongoing flooding and mold

New Stonewater Apartments LLC has an open property maintenance code-violation case at 11353 Tazwell Dr after ongoing flooding caused significant water damage and widespread mold throughout the Stone Water Apartments buildings. Residents report musty odors and health concerns, and the case calls for immediate inspections to find and fix the source of the flooding, remove water-damaged materials, and complete professional mold remediation so units are safe and habitable.

#3 Top Scoop Code Violation

3217 Springfield Dr opened Property Maintenance Case ENF-PMNT-26-014364

A property maintenance complaint (code violation) at 3217 Springfield Dr alleges prolonged water problems from November through April that caused extensive interior and flooring damage. The open case names owner Nyamugisha Neema and says plumbers cut 6'×11" and 5'×5" openings that revealed heavy mold, prompting an asthmatic, tumor-survivor tenant to vacate and raising health concerns for neighboring residents, including a child and visitors undergoing chemo.

#4 Top Scoop Code Violation

1418 CHEROKEE RD Code Violation: Verify LG&E utility clearance for pool

A property maintenance case has been opened for 1418 Cherokee Rd after a neighbor asked Louisville Metro to verify utility clearances and whether Louisville Gas & Electric (LG&E) was consulted about a residential pool under construction. Owner Lewis Thomas R had planned a small cocktail pool and masonry privacy wall, but the pool was reportedly moved when the original location conflicted with an underground natural gas service line—neighbors say the new placement still looks very close to that line. The request asks codes enforcement to confirm LG&E notification, easement and setback compliance, that the built pool matches approved dimensions and the Certificate of Appropriateness, and that the work doesn’t create a gas-safety hazard for the Cherokee Triangle Historic Preservation District.
